The technology for clean-burning fluidized-bed combustion of coal existed 20+ years ago. The central problem is the U.S. didn't have, and still doesn't have a comprehensive energy policy. As long as there are obstructionist politicians who serve special interests that consider energy resource use as wrong, evil, bad or whatever, the United States will continue to struggle with the issue.
